Understanding the Mechanics of Crash Games
At its heart, a crash game is fundamentally simple. A player places a bet, and a multiplier begins to increase, starting typically at 1x. This multiplier represents the potential profit the player could receive if they cash out at that moment. The longer the player waits, the higher the multiplier climbs, and the greater the potential payout. However, with each passing second, the risk of a ‘crash’ increases exponentially. The crash is a randomly triggered event that instantly ends the round, and any players who haven't cashed out lose their initial bet. This core mechanic revolves around a Random Number Generator (RNG) that determines the crash point, ensuring fairness and unpredictability. Different platforms may employ slightly different RNG algorithms, influencing the pace and distribution of crash events, which is another factor players consider when choosing where to play.

Strategies for Playing Crash Games
While crash games are largely based on luck, employing certain strategies can significantly improve a player's chances of winning. One popular strategy is the "low and slow" approach, where players aim to cash out at relatively low multipliers, such as 1.2x to 1.5x. This strategy prioritizes consistency and minimizing risk. Another strategy is the "martingale" system, where players double their bet after each loss, hoping to recover their losses with a single win. However, the martingale system can be risky, as it requires a large bankroll and can lead to substantial losses if a losing streak persists. The Psychological Aspect of Crash Games
Crash games aren’t simply about mathematical probabilities; they also tap into the psychological aspects of risk-taking and reward anticipation. The increasing multiplier triggers a dopamine rush, creating a sense of excitement and anticipation. This can be particularly addictive, as players become fixated on the potential for a large payout. The fear of missing out (FOMO) can also play a significant role, leading players to delay cashing out in hopes of achieving a higher multiplier, only to eventually witness a crash. Understanding these psychological biases is crucial for maintaining a rational mindset and making informed decisions. The Influence of Social Proof and Peer Pressure
Online communities and live chat features often accompany crash games, fostering a sense of social interaction. Witnessing other players’ wins (or losses) can subtly influence a player’s own decision-making. “Social proof” – the tendency to follow the actions of others – can lead players to take unnecessary risks or delay cashing out based on the perceived success of other individuals. It is critical to remember that each round is independent and that past outcomes do not predict future results. Furthermore, it’s important to avoid being swayed by the opinions or strategies of others and to remain focused on your own pre-determined risk management plan. Maintaining a detached and objective perspective is key to avoiding the pitfalls of peer pressure.

Navigating Regulatory Landscapes and Responsible Gaming
As the popularity of crash games continues to grow, regulatory bodies are increasingly focusing on establishing clear guidelines and safeguards. Jurisdictions are beginning to address the unique characteristics of these games, ensuring fair play and protecting vulnerable players from potential harm. This includes enforcing strict licensing requirements for operators, implementing age verification measures, and promoting responsible gambling practices. A key aspect of responsible gaming is self-exclusion programs, which allow players to voluntarily block themselves from accessing online casinos. Reputable platforms offer comprehensive responsible gaming tools, including deposit limits, loss limits, and session time limits, empowering players to control their gambling behavior and prevent potential problems.
